they all boil down to things that you can do if you have a full OS
underneath to do other things that we want to do.

for example we have a serial logging setup where all our firewalls and
servers on the different network segments have syslog set to send the logs
through a uni-directional serial connection (the data wire going to the
server is cut). this is fairly simple to do with syslog, but with a nokia
we would have to have it syslog over the network, then have another box
receive the syslog data and push it over the serial port.

we also have some somple log analysis reports that get generated on the
firewall nightly and e-mailed out. (useage reports, etc) that would be
more difficult to setup if we have to get the logs to a different server
first.

In our case the 4 locations that we are looking at putting the firewall-1
boses are seperated by several other firewalls and as such it is not the
case that there is a single box that they can all talk to for these
functions.

there are a few other things (and more keep popping up) but that's the
basic idea.
